Choosing Keychains That Reflect Your Identity

Selecting keychains isn’t just about aesthetics—it’s about alignment with your lifestyle and values. Consider these guiding principles:

  • Material Matters: Metal, resin, wood, enamel, or recycled materials each convey different textures and messages. Polished brass suggests sophistication; hand-painted ceramic reflects artistry.
  • Sentimental Value: Incorporate charms from meaningful places—a miniature Eiffel Tower from Paris, a tiny book charm for bibliophiles, or a zodiac symbol.
  • Functionality Meets Form: Multi-use keychains with bottle openers, mini flashlights, or USB drives blend utility with flair.
  • Scale & Proportion: Oversized charms work on larger bags; delicate chains suit clutches or minimalist designs.
Tip: Start with one statement keychain and build around it. Avoid overcrowding—three to five pieces usually strike the perfect balance.

Styling Strategies for Maximum Impact

How you arrange your keychains affects both visual appeal and usability. Thoughtful layering creates depth without chaos.

Layer by Length

Attach longer chains toward the back of the zipper pull and shorter ones in front. This creates a cascading effect that draws the eye naturally.

Color Coordination

Match keychain tones to your bag’s hardware (e.g., gold-toned charms with gold zippers) or use contrast for boldness (matte black resin on a cream leather bag).

Thematic Grouping

Create mini-narratives: travel-themed (airplane, passport, globe), nature-inspired (leaf, animal, stone), or pop culture tributes (movie quotes, band logos).

Care and Maintenance Tips

Even decorative elements need upkeep. Dust, friction, and weather exposure can dull finishes or weaken connections.

  • Wipe metal charms monthly with a microfiber cloth to prevent tarnishing.
  • For fabric or tassels, spot-clean with mild soap and air-dry flat.
  • Inspect attachment points every few weeks. Replace worn rings before they snap.
  • Remove keychains before machine washing fabric bags or storing long-term.

Checklist: Building a Cohesive Keychain Ensemble

Use this checklist before finalizing your setup:

  • ✅ Does at least one piece have personal meaning?
  • ✅ Are materials compatible with your bag’s fabric (e.g., no sharp edges on delicate silk)?
  • ✅ Can you easily access your keys without untangling multiple chains?
  • ✅ Is the total weight balanced? (Heavy clusters can strain zippers.)
  • ✅ Do colors or themes align with your usual style?
  • ✅ Have you tested movement? (Walk with the bag to check for snagging.)

Frequently Asked Questions

Can keychains damage my bag over time?

Yes, if improperly chosen. Heavy or jagged keychains may fray straps or stress stitching near attachment points. Stick to lightweight designs and inspect regularly for wear. Using a dedicated keychain loop instead of the main zipper can also reduce strain.

Where can I find unique, high-quality keychains?

Support independent creators on platforms like Etsy or Instagram. Local craft fairs, museum gift shops, and international markets often carry one-of-a-kind pieces. For durability, look for solid metals, kiln-fired ceramics, or ethically sourced wood.

Is it okay to mix expensive bags with inexpensive keychains?

Absolutely. Luxury brands don’t require luxury-only accessories. In fact, juxtaposing a $2,000 handbag with a $5 handmade charm can make the look feel more authentic and approachable. Focus on cohesion, not cost parity.
